External rhinoplasty technique

Ann Plast Surg. 1990 Nov;25(5):388-96. doi: 10.1097/00000637-199011000-00007.

Abstract

External rhinoplasty is a valuable tool in the surgical armamentarium of all nasal surgeons. It does not change the dynamics of the operation but offers a new method of exposure. The purpose of this paper is to present our experience with the external rhinoplasty technique in 601 patients, and review the results and complications of this approach to nasal surgery. Two patient reports are presented to demonstrate use of the technique in nasal surgery.
